- Understanding Betting Odds
Knowing the odds associated with each hand can be the difference between a winning streak and falling flat. In poker, odds describe the relationship between the probabilities of different outcomes. For instance, if you flip a coin, the odds of it landing on heads or tails are straightforward. In poker, however, itâs a little more complex due to various player actions and deck compositions. By calculating pot odds, which compares the current size of the pot to the bet you must call, players can determine whether they are making a profitable decision. Popular Poker Variants
Texas Hold'em
Texas Hold'em holds a special place in the hearts of many players. What sets this game apart is its blend of strategy and luck, which certainly contributes to its fame. One of the core characteristics of Texas Hold'em is the way it uses community cards, allowing players to combine these with their own two hole cards to make the best five-card hand. This not only fuels strategic thinking but challenges players to read their opponents effectively.
The unique feature of Texas Hold'em lies in its accessibility; even newcomers can quickly grasp the basic rules, making it a popular choice for both new and seasoned players. However, itâs not without its disadvantages; the competitive nature and depth of strategy can intimidate inexperienced players. Still, mastering Texas Hold'em can be highly rewarding.
Omaha
Omaha differs from Texas Hold'em in a critical wayâit offers players four hole cards instead of two. This allows for greater possibilities in hand-building and makes for a richer gaming experience. The game is highly regarded for its strategic depth. Each player must use exactly two of their hole cards and three from the community cards to form a hand, adding complexity and engaging decision-making at its finest.
This unique aspect makes Omaha an exciting variant for those who enjoy strategic planning and multi-dimensional thinking. However, with greater opportunities for strong hands also comes heightened competition, often exposing weaker players early in the game. The thrill and mental challenge that Omaha presents is certainly a beneficial aspect worth mentioning in this article.
Seven Card Stud
Traditional yet captivating, Seven Card Stud maintains its charm by not using community cards at all. Instead, players receive a mix of face-up and face-down cards, intensifying the necessity for memory and observation skills. One of the key characteristics here is the emphasis on predicting opponentsâ actions based on visible cards, honing a playerâs instincts and judgment skills.
The unique feature of Seven Card Stud is that it's more about individual hands rather than the communal nature seen in Hold'em and Omaha. While it lacks the wild popularity of the former two, it offers a distinctive experience that appeals to players seeking something classic. However, its complexity might dissuade novice players, underscoring the necessity for some foundational skill or understanding of poker dynamics.

Basic Strategies for New Players


For those stepping into the poker room for the first time, having a steady plan is crucial. Here are some fundamental strategies to keep in mind:
- Know Your Hands: Familiarize yourself with hand rankings. Knowing what beats what is the cornerstone of poker.
- Position is Key: Always consider your position at the table. Being seated later lets you gauge the actions of your opponents, allowing more informed decisions.
- Play Tight and Aggressive: It's tempting to play every hand, but staying selective about your entries pays off. Focus on strong hands and play aggressively when you do.
- Observe Opponents: Bingo! Taking mental notes on how others play can provide insights into their strategies. Look for betting patterns and tendencies.
- Manage Your Bankroll: Set strict limits before starting to play. It helps prevent chasing losses, which can spiral quickly.
These initial steps equip new players to develop a sound strategy as they acclimate to the casino environment.

Common Pitfalls in Poker
Diving into a poker game without a sound strategy can lead many down a slippery slope. Here are a few common missteps that can trip up even the most enthusiastic players:
- Playing Too Many Hands: It's tempting to get involved in every hand, but this can lead to quick losses. Experienced players often know when to fold, which is just as important as when to bet.
- Overvaluing Hands: Just because you have pocket aces doesnât mean you should play them aggressively. Misreading the board or opponents can cloud judgment, causing players to overbet.
- Ignoring Position: The order in which players act can heavily influence decisions. Being too aggressive from an earlier position can catch even seasoned players off guard.
- Chasing Losses: Losing a hand can trigger an emotional response; trying to win it back on the next hand is often unwise. Patience is a virtue in poker.
Recognizing these pitfalls can empower players to approach the game with a clearer mindset.
Managing Bankroll Effectively
Another aspect to consider is the management of oneâs bankroll. This isnât just about having enough money to play; itâs a disciplined approach to gaming that can keep you in the game longer:
- Set a Budget: Before you step foot in the poker room, determine how much money youâre willing to risk. This is your bankroll and itâs crucial to stick to it.
- Know Your Limits: Sample different stakes and understand where you fit within those ranges. Playing beyond your comfort zone can escalate risks.
- Track Your Wins and Losses: Keeping tabs on your performance allows you to see patterns, helping refine your strategies and decisions.
- Be Prepared to Walk Away: Sometimes, the best decision is to step back. Winning a little and walking away can often be more beneficial than staying and risking it all in hopes of a massive win.
Having a firm handle on bankroll management not only bolsters financial security but also adds to the enjoyment of the game.
